No, Marriott brought this on when they mis-matched status after the acquisition was announced.

SPG Platinum with 25 stays or 50 nights was matched to MR Platinum requiring 75 nights.

MR Platinum Premier (unpublished criteria but data points suggest consistent 125 nights and top 2% spend) also matched to SPG Platinum 25. If MR PP had been matched to SPG Platinum 100 then less hard feelings would be in play.

But someone chose only see metal color and not look to underlying criteria.
